
Artland

Leave the world behind and step into Artland, a colorful and fascinating world filled with new creatures and mysterious spaces. In Artland, the sun is half coral pink and half jade and snow comes down in triangles (and doesn't melt)! Buses are floating rings – no drivers needed – and with the exception of Slimes board meetings, there’s no government here.
Do Ho Suh and Children: Artland was created in 2016 by Seoul-born artist Do Ho Suh and his two young daughters. Together they made an expansive, ever-growing world out of multi-colored clay and imagination.
When you enter Artland, you become part of its world. Using air-dry clay, you’ll help shape this universe and build your own places in it. Come visit Artland anytime while the museum is open in the brand-new Hub, a space build for community, learning, and artmaking.
